Associates will develop deliverables and work side-by-side with others on the deal team to create pitch materials, formulate business valuations, and prepare marketing materials. BCA operates with lean teams and Associates must be able to manage processes from pitch to close. BCA has a robust pipeline of prospective and active engagements and is seeking a candidate that can make an immediate impact.Job Duties:* Supports the execution and the origination of M&A transactions* Oversees the development of financial models, including DCF, accretion/dilution, LBO, comparable trading, and transaction analyses* Analyzes companies and industries and works directly with client management teams* Prepares pitch books, offering memoranda and management presentations* Serves as key point of contact for client's management team as well as third party providers* Structures and manages deal marketing process* Manages several projects concurrently and works effectively both as an individual and as a leader of a team, including managing analysts* Participates in the recruitment, development, and training of junior bankers (analysts, summer analysts/associates, incoming classes)* Develops internal BDO relationships as well as external relationships through deal execution and marketing* Other duties as requiredQualifications, Knowledge, Skills and Abilities:### Education* Bachelor's degree from a four-year institution, required; focus in Finance, Accounting, or Economics, preferred* Master of Business Administration, preferred### Experience* Three (3) or more years of relevant investment banking, private equity or related financial services experience, preferredLicense/Certifications:* FINRA Series 79 and 63, preferredSoftware:* Proficient in of Microsoft Office Suite and research tools such as S&P CapitalIQ, FactSet, Bloomberg, and Intralinks, preferredOther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:* Excellent verbal and written communication skills* Superior analytical and research skills* Solid organizational skills, especially the ability to meet project deadlines with a focus on details* Ability to successfully multi-task while working independently or within a group* Ability to work in a deadline-driven environment and handle multiple projects simultaneously* Ability to successfully interact with professionals at all levels* Ability to travel, as necessaryIndividual salaries that are offered to a candidate are determined after consideration of numerous factors including but not limited to the candidate's qualifications, experience, skills, and geography.National Range: $125,000 - $175,000Maryland Range: $125,000 - $175,000NYC/Long Island/Westchester Range: $125,000 - $175,000 #J-18808-Ljbffr
